JOB OVERVIEW

We're a 3PL company based in Miami, FL, shipping thousands of packages every day for a range of e-commerce brands. We're growing our customer service team and looking for an experienced CS representative to help keep our clients' shipping operations running smoothly.

This role is a strong fit for someone with a background in e-commerce and hands-on experience using a WMS such as Warehance, ShipStation, or a similar platform. If you've managed orders and resolved shipping issues before, you'll get up to speed quickly.

To be upfront, this is a new position for us. You'd be our first CS VA, so expect our processes to evolve as we build this role out together. We're looking for someone who's open to change and willing to share ideas. If you like having input on how things are done and seeing your suggestions put into action, you'll do well here.
What you'll be doing: The brands we ship for have their own customer service teams, and when they run into a shipping problem like a delayed order, wrong item, lost package, or incorrect address, they come to us. You'll be the point of contact who investigates the issue, finds out what went wrong, and resolves it. You won't be working with end consumers directly, just the support teams from our client brands.

You'll handle these issues inside our warehouse system, Warehance, and coordinate with our team through Telegram and Slack.

What we're looking for:

-Experience in e-commerce customer service or logistics support
-Hands-on experience with a WMS (Warehance, ShipStation, or similar)
-Strong written English and clear communication
-Solid attention to detail and the ability to follow an issue through to resolution
-Reliable internet, a quiet workspace, and the discipline to work independently

Pay and schedule: $6.50 per hour. Working hours fall between 7am and 3pm EST, Monday through Friday. The role is flexible since you only work when there are open tickets, so you won't be tied to a full eight-hour shift. When tickets come in, you handle them. When it's quiet, your time is your own.
